This bed bridge weighs only 0.62 lb, so it's easy to handle and install. It works to connect two twin-sized mattresses and holds them securely together to prevent them from sliding apart.
I've spent my fair share of nights on two single beds loosely joined together with a fitted sheet to make a 'double,' and if there's one word that springs to mind, it's uncomfortable. There's something about that gap between the mattresses, which inevitably grows ever wider as the night wears on, that seems to swallow you up, and any efforts to avoid it are, more often than not, futile. That's where the Fix The Gap Foam Bed Bridge, available at Walmart, comes in handy.
Its simplicity only adds to the cleverness – and the low price tag. Simply pop it between two twin mattresses, and it bridges the gap between them, creating an expansive sleep space that won't drift apart in the middle of the night.
For that reason, it's not just suitable for guest bedrooms, either. Using one could also help you avoid a sleep divorce if you share a bed with your partner, but have different firmness preferences. Simply buy the ideal twin-sized mattress for you and your partner, and put this between them for a seamless, comfortable look and finish.
